Trezor, a leading hardware wallet manufacturer, is making significant strides to enhance the usability of its products. At the forefront of this initiative is the introduction of a new paid onboarding service and the launch of the Trezor Safe 5 wallet. These developments are designed to make self-custody more accessible and secure for both new and experienced cryptocurrency users.

Improving Usability

During the BTC Prague 2023 conference, Trezor CEO Matej Zak emphasized the company's commitment to usability. He highlighted that the usability of hardware wallets plays a crucial role in increasing the adoption of self-custody solutions. "Educate hard and build simply" is the motto driving Trezor's strategy to simplify the self-custody process and make it less intimidating for users transitioning from exchange-based custody​.

The Trezor Safe 5 Wallet

Trezor's latest hardware wallet, the Safe 5, represents the next generation of secure cryptocurrency storage. The wallet supports over 7,000 cryptocurrencies and features enhanced security measures, including a third-party secure element vendor that allows Trezor to publish any potential vulnerabilities. This commitment to open-source principles ensures that users can trust the security of their devices.

Additional Features

Alongside the Safe 5 wallet, Trezor has introduced the Trezor Keep Metal, a robust physical backup solution for private keys. This tool is designed to protect recovery phrases against physical threats like fire and water, offering an additional layer of security for users' funds. The Keep Metal is available in various configurations to support different backup methods, including the 12-word, 24-word, and Shamir backup systems​.
